Awesome-LM-SSP
The Awesome-LM-SSP repository is a collection of resources related to the trustworthiness of large models (LMs) across multiple dimensions, with a special focus on multi-modal LMs. It includes papers, surveys, toolkits, competitions, and leaderboards. The resources are categorized into three main dimensions: safety, security, and privacy. Within each dimension, there are several subcategories. For example, the safety dimension includes subcategories such as jailbreak, alignment, deepfake, ethics, fairness, hallucination, prompt injection, and toxicity. The security dimension includes subcategories such as adversarial examples, poisoning, and system security. The privacy dimension includes subcategories such as contamination, copyright, data reconstruction, membership inference attacks, model extraction, privacy-preserving computation, and unlearning.

ChatAFL
ChatAFL is a protocol fuzzer guided by large language models (LLMs) that extracts machine-readable grammar for protocol mutation, increases message diversity, and breaks coverage plateaus. It integrates with ProfuzzBench for stateful fuzzing of network protocols, providing smooth integration. The artifact includes modified versions of AFLNet and ProfuzzBench, source code for ChatAFL with proposed strategies, and scripts for setup, execution, analysis, and cleanup. Users can analyze data, construct plots, examine LLM-generated grammars, enriched seeds, and state-stall responses, and reproduce results with downsized experiments. Customization options include modifying fuzzers, tuning parameters, adding new subjects, troubleshooting, and working on GPT-4. Limitations include interaction with OpenAI's Large Language Models and a hard limit of 150,000 tokens per minute.

vulnerability-analysis
The NVIDIA AI Blueprint for Vulnerability Analysis for Container Security showcases accelerated analysis on common vulnerabilities and exposures (CVE) at an enterprise scale, reducing mitigation time from days to seconds. It enables security analysts to determine software package vulnerabilities using large language models (LLMs) and retrieval-augmented generation (RAG). The blueprint is designed for security analysts, IT engineers, and AI practitioners in cybersecurity. It requires NVAIE developer license and API keys for vulnerability databases, search engines, and LLM model services. Hardware requirements include L40 GPU for pipeline operation and optional LLM NIM and Embedding NIM. The workflow involves LLM pipeline for CVE impact analysis, utilizing LLM planner, agent, and summarization nodes. The blueprint uses NVIDIA NIM microservices and Morpheus Cybersecurity AI SDK for vulnerability analysis.
